What To Do With Your Retirement $$$

    With a rocky couple of days on Wall Street, many are worried about retirement money and if their savings will remain intact. Today we spoke to financial planner Mark Bass about what to do with retirement funds, as the Dow plummets day after day. For many, there's talk of pulling their money out of the stock market, but Bass says it's probably best to stay put and ride out these troubled times. Of course, that all depends on if you can handle the fluctuating market.

    "Generally it's a function of someone's temperament, how well they sleep at night," says Bass. "Because long term, stocks have been a well-performing asset-class, maybe the best-performing asset class, but you have to be able to take these kinds of downturns in stride, and that's really easier said than done."
